Proximity session mobility
First Claim
1. A method of establishing communication between devices through an identity module, said method comprising:
- registering a receiving device by said identity module operating on a server that can be wirelessly connected to the receiving device and to a sending device;
assigning a unique identifier to said receiving device by said identity module;
scanning devices using the sending device to identify available devices within a proximity of the sending device;
discovering said receiving device from among the devices by the sending device;
receiving said unique identifier of said receiving device at said sending device;
using the sending device, validating the receiving device with information on the identity module;
receiving a query from said sending device, the query comprising said unique identifier of said sending device;
obtaining said unique identifier of the receiving device from a message payload;
providing information about said receiving device to said sending device;
displaying device information about the receiving device on the sending device;
providing connection requirements to said sending device by said identity module;
using said identity module, initiating a background operation to link said receiving device and said sending device via a communication channel for sharing exchanged content between said receiving device and said sending device;
using an exchange agent module on said sending device, establishing a sharing connection with an exchange agent module on the receiving device; and
sharing one or more of static information and dynamic information between the exchange agent module on said sending device and the exchange agent module on the receiving device,wherein the receiving device can perform one or more of discarding the static information, redirecting the static information, editing the dynamic information, discarding the dynamic information, pushing the dynamic information back to the sending device, and redirecting the dynamic information.
14 Assignments
0 Petitions
Accused Products
Abstract
A system and method for seamless exchange and interaction of multimedia content between communication devices in a network are disclosed. The method can include the discovery and identification of devices within proximity of a sending device. The found devices can be authenticated through unique identifiers established during registration. Connection requirements can be determined based on the identifiers associated with the found devices and the sending device. In turn, the sender can establish a connection with the found devices using the connection requirements. The sending device can share or serve as a remote control to redirect and navigate the content, with a simple action or a gesture command, to the found device. The shared multimedia content, can either reside on the sender'"'"'s mobile device or on a remote server within a connected network.
-
Citations
13 Claims
-
1. A method of establishing communication between devices through an identity module, said method comprising:
-
registering a receiving device by said identity module operating on a server that can be wirelessly connected to the receiving device and to a sending device; assigning a unique identifier to said receiving device by said identity module; scanning devices using the sending device to identify available devices within a proximity of the sending device; discovering said receiving device from among the devices by the sending device; receiving said unique identifier of said receiving device at said sending device; using the sending device, validating the receiving device with information on the identity module; receiving a query from said sending device, the query comprising said unique identifier of said sending device; obtaining said unique identifier of the receiving device from a message payload; providing information about said receiving device to said sending device; displaying device information about the receiving device on the sending device; providing connection requirements to said sending device by said identity module; using said identity module, initiating a background operation to link said receiving device and said sending device via a communication channel for sharing exchanged content between said receiving device and said sending device; using an exchange agent module on said sending device, establishing a sharing connection with an exchange agent module on the receiving device; and sharing one or more of static information and dynamic information between the exchange agent module on said sending device and the exchange agent module on the receiving device, wherein the receiving device can perform one or more of discarding the static information, redirecting the static information, editing the dynamic information, discarding the dynamic information, pushing the dynamic information back to the sending device, and redirecting the dynamic information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
Specification